A new award for architects Christoph Ingenhoven and Ray Brown: the skyscraper they designed at "1 Bligh Street" in Sydney has won the International Highrise Award 2012, chosen over four other finalists:
The Pinnacle @Duxton (Singapore) by ARC Studio Architecture + Urbanism,
The Troika (Kuala Lumpur) by Foster + Partners,
Eight Spruce Street (New York) by Gehry Partners,
Absolute Towers (Mississauga, Canada) by MAD.
The prize jury acknowledged the exceptional architectural quality of "1 Bligh Street", a project that aims to meet the inhabitants? needs rather than create an architectural landmark.
For the first time in the history of the Highrise Award, a special mention has been awarded for renovation of an existing skyscraper, the Deutsche Bank Tower in Frankfurt, designed by gmp – von Gerkan, Marg und Partner + Mario Bellini Architects.
An exhibition underway at DAM in Frankfurt presents the award-winning highrises in large-scale models, photographs, drawings and videos.
